This 1967 recording by the avant-garde saxophonist - his second for ESP-Disk' - features Tyler on alto sax with accompaniment from David Baker (cello), Brent McKesson (bass), and Kent Brinkley (bass). The album starts out with "Cha-Lacy's Out East," which revisits a theme from his first album as leader. The proceedings are heady free-form avant-jazz, reaching into cosmic realms with string-heavy backing providing soaring atmospheres. Tyler cut legendary records as a sideman to Albert Ayler, but as a leader he proves to be one of the most advanced, challenging, and exploratory players of the late '60s avant-garde. Issued in digipak format with original artwork and new liner notes by Clifford Allen.
